$53.2K – $70.5K a year 1 day ago Qualifications Bilingual Spanish Microsoft Excel 5 years English Bachelor’s degree Portuguese Business Administration Office management Senior level Business Leadership Communication skills Full Job Description We are looking for a results-driven Finance Manager to lead all financial activities and oversee the daily administrative operations of BPOD. This role is critical to ensuring operational efficiency, cross-functional alignment, and the delivery of timely financial insights to support strategic business decisions.

Key Responsibilities:

Consolidate the annual budget, monitor execution, and analyze variances between actual and forecasted expenses. Supervise functional areas including billing, collections, vendor payments, operations, and logistics. Prepare and deliver weekly, monthly, and quarterly financial reports to senior leadership. Support the commercial team with client negotiations. Lead financial forecasting processes, including cash flow projections and quarterly or semi-annual expense variance reviews. Ensure administrative processes for inventory, fixed assets, and procurement are aligned with company policies. Ensure compliance with tax and administrative regulations. Directly oversee the company’s administrative areas, including accounting, finance, procurement, logistics, and general administration, ensuring alignment with financial and operational objectives. Review and approve administrative reports related to travel expenses, advances, reimbursements, and per diem, ensuring policy compliance and budget control. Manage implementation and execution of commission-based compensation plans, in coordination with the CFO and Compliance. This position may take on other tasks or projects as assigned.

Requirements:

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Accounting, or a related field. Minimum of 5 years in administrative or office management roles. Strong leadership, organizational, and communication skills. Experience with compensation structures, including commission plans, is a plus. Familiarity with ISO standards or certifications is an advantage.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el, ERP systems, and collaborative tools. Fully bilingual in Spanish and English; Portuguese is a plus.
